Senior Thesis: A Scriptural Rosary Prayer Book
For my Senior Thesis project, I created a small handbound Scriptural Rosary Prayer Book. Inspired by the illustrations found in Illuminated manuscripts, I adorned the pages with scrolling floral borders which reflected the mysteries to be meditated on. Pink and cream carnations to symbolize Joy for the Joyful Mysteries, Bluebells, otherwise known as Our Lady's thimble, to symbolize the work done during Our Lord's ministry for the Luminous Mysteries, Red Roses to symbolize sorrow for the Sorrowful Mysteries, and white lilies for to symbolize joy and triumph for the Glorious Mysteries. In addition I created blue fleur de lies borders for the introduction pages, and a border with all of the flowers to adorn the pages with the prayers to be used at the beginning and end of Rosary regardless of which Mysteries you chose to meditate on. Gold leaf was added to the capitals on all the headings, to give a more sacred feel to the book. All scripture verses were carefully selected from the Revised Standard Version Catholic Edition.
